China Needs High-speed Magnetically Levitated Train
Yan Luguang
Strategic Study of CAE 2000, Volume 2, Issue 5, Pages 8-13
The development, main features and advantages of the high-speed magnetically levitated train are shortlyIt is particularly suitable for the development of the future high-speed passenger transportation networkSome suggestions to develop high-speed magnetically levitated train technology in China are presented
